Python取整运算符
Python中的取整运算符是一种用来对浮点数进行取整运算的操作符。在Python中,我们可以使用两种方法来进行取整运算,即向下取整和向上取整。
向下取整
向下取整是指将一个浮点数向下取整至最接近的整数。在Python中,我们可以使用math.floor()函数来进行向下取整操作。
import math
x = 3.14159
result = math.floor(x)
print(result)
运行结果为:
3
在上面的示例代码中,我们首先导入了math模块,然后定义了一个浮点数x,并使用math.floor()函数对x进行了向下取整操作。最终的结果是3,即3.14159向下取整为3。
向上取整
向上取整是指将一个浮点数向上取整至最接近的整数。在Python中,我们可以使用math.ceil()函数来进行向上取整操作。
import math
x = 3.14159
result = math.ceil(x)
print(result)
运行结果为:
4
在上面的示例代码中,我们同样首先导入了math模块,然后定义了一个浮点数x,并使用math.ceil()函数对x进行了向上取整操作。最终的结果是4,即3.14159向上取整为4。
取整除 – //
除了向下取整和向上取整,Python还提供了取整除操作符”//”,它可以将两个数相除后取整。
x = 10
y = 3
result = x // y
print(result)
运行结果为:
3
在上面的示例代码中,我们定义了两个整数x和y,并使用”//”操作符对它们进行了取整除操作。最终的结果是3,即10除以3取整为3。
通过以上的介绍,我们了解了Python中的取整运算符,包括向下取整、向上取整和取整除。这些操作符在处理浮点数时非常有用,能够帮助我们快速进行数值计算和处理。